RSP Coutts is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Inorganic Chemistry and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ials. According to data from OpenAlex, RSP Coutts has authored 32 papers receiving a total of 554 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 25 papers in Organic Chemistry, 17 papers in Inorganic Chemistry and 8 papers in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ials. Recurrent topics in RSP Coutts’s work include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(22 papers), Synthesis and characterization of novel inorganic/organometallic compounds (11 papers) and Magnetism in coordination complexes (8 papers). RSP Coutts is often cited by papers focused on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(22 papers), Synthesis and characterization of novel inorganic/organometallic compounds (11 papers) and Magnetism in coordination complexes (8 papers). RSP Coutts collaborates with scholars based in Australia. RSP Coutts's co-authors include P. C. WAILES, PC Wailes, R.L. Martin, H. Weigold, R. L. MARTIN, Allan J. Canty and JM Swan and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Organometallic Chemistry, Australian Journal of Chemistry and Elsevier eBooks.
